Earning a Master of Business Administration (MBA) degree can be an important step in a business-related career. Whether professionals are starting toward the bottom of the ladder or want to add more skills to change careers or level up, an MBA can be a great option.

According to the Graduate Management Admissions Council, more than 96% of recruiters at Fortune Global 100 companies have MBA graduates as part of their hiring forecast as of 2018, and 90% of recruiters at Fortune Global 500 say the same thing.

An MBA can give professionals a leg up when they are trying to land positions at competitive corporations. In some cases, it may provide the best chance at getting in the door.

Even for those who are committed to their careers, it can be hard to devote enough time to advancing their education while working or taking care of families.

A full-time MBA program can take up to two years to complete, on average, and most people don’t have the flexibility to stop working that long. Fortunately, it’s possible to learn how to do an MBA part-time at the right institution.

How to Do an MBA Part-Time

Working on a part-time MBA means it isn’t necessary to put off professional development — or earnings, in the name of education.

To earn an MBA part time, students take fewer courses per semester to earn the credits they need for the degree. The Flex MBA at Saint Rose allows students to fit coursework into their lives instead of shifting everything around to fit a particular course load.
